Jesmond with Claire Novis

Claire is one of Kay's advanced students who is now a teacher and performer in her own right. Claire is a member of the Tarab Dance Company and has performed at the Festival Fringe in Edinburgh with the show. Claire is also a fully qualified JWAAD teacher and member of the JTA.

Claire has a beautiful soft and fluid style which is a joy to watch. Her teaching style is warm and friendly and her class is very popular. Claire teaches regularly at our Northern Residential Course, 'Farida at Ford' to rave reviews. Claire is also studying for her JWAAD Teacher Training Diploma.
